Baidu Targeted by ‘Iranian Cyber Army’ Hack Attack

January 12th, 2010
China's largest search engine, Baidu.com, said that it was temporarily shut down after a cyberattack Tuesday. Hackers briefly blocked access to China's top search engine by steering traffic to another Web site where a group reportedly calling itself the "Iranian Cyber Army" claimed responsibility. "Services on Baidu's main Web site were interrupted today due to external manipulation of its DNS (domain name server) in the U.S.," said Baidu spokesperson Victor Tseng.
